Success depends on how you manipulate the terrain. You aren't spraying a hose; instead, you are carving a path for the water to flow naturally toward the burning plants. It is a hypercasual experience that feels intuitive but demands a sharp eye for detail. Since this is a 1 Player game, the pressure is all on you to find the fastest route before everything turns to ash.
To conquer every level, you need to think about the flow. In this 2D environment, gravity is your best friend and your worst enemy. Don't just dig randomly; plan your canal to ensure the liquid hits the fire at the right angle. As you progress, the levels become more complex, requiring a mix of casual gaming instincts and serious puzzle solving. Experiment with different digging depths to control the speed of the stream. The more efficient your path, the faster you save the greenery.
